Danger
Do not throw, drop, tilt or upset the battery, or
allow it to undergo physical impact.
Doing so could cause the electrolyte to leak.
If contact of the electrolyte with the eye, skin,
or clothing occurs, immediately wash it off with
plenty of water.
In particular, if eye contact or ingestion
occurs, immediately seek medical treatment.
If the electrolyte spills over the machine etc.,
wipe away with a wet cloth and flush the
affected area with plenty of water.
The electrolyte contained in the battery is
sulfuric acid.
Contact of the electrolyte (sulfuric acid) with
the skin could cause blindness or burns.
Contact of the electrolyte with the machine
etc. could cause damage to the machine.
Danger
Danger
Do not allow anyone to handle the battery who
does not fully understand the correct battery
handling procedures and relevant dangers.
When handling the battery, wear protective
glasses and rubber gloves, etc.
If the battery has an unusual odor, if the
electrolyte level goes down unusually fast, or
if the electrolyte leaks, do not continue to use
the battery.
Failure to observe these precautions could
cause a fire, explosion, etc.
Caution
If the electrolyte overflows, neutralize it with
bicarbonate etc. until the bubbles disappear,
and wash out with plenty of water.
Failure to do so could cause corrosion of the
surrounding area or environmental pollution.
If deformation of the exterior of the battery is
observed, do not continue to use it.
Doing so could result in damage to the battery
or electrolyte leaks.
Use extra care when handling the battery,
and if any problems are found, replace the
battery with a new one.
Carry or store the battery with care so that it
does not fall or become damaged.

Inspection of the battery
Before inspecting the battery, be sure to stop
the engine and remove the key.
Danger
Danger
Do not allow anyone to handle the battery who
does not fully understand the correct battery
handling procedures and relevant dangers.
When handling the battery, wear protective
glasses and rubber gloves, etc. The
electrolyte may cause blindness or burns.
Never use an open flame when inspecting the
battery.
Do not connect the positive and negative
battery terminals to each other using a
metallic tool etc.
Doing so could cause a fire or explosion.
Always keep the electrolyte level above the
LOWER (minimum level line) limit.
Failure to do so could cause the battery life to
be shortened or cause explosion.
Loose connections between cable and
terminal, or corroded terminals could cause a
fire or explosion.
Warning
Before handling the battery such as for
purposes of inspection etc, touch a metal part
of the machine body with your bare hand in
order to remove static electricity.
Static electricity could cause a fire.
When cleaning the battery, do not use dry
cloth or tissue paper, etc.
Static electricity could cause a fire.
When adding distilled water, keep the
electrolyte level below the UPPER (maximum
level line) limit.
Failure to do so could cause the electrolyte to
leak.
